Fitness Apps: the Good, the Bad, and the Ugly

In today’s digital age, the world of fitness has been revolutionized by the introduction of fitness apps. These apps offer a convenient way for individuals to track their workouts, monitor their progress, and stay motivated in achieving their fitness goals. However, like any technology, fitness apps come with their own set of pros and cons. In this article, we will explore the good, the bad, and the ugly sides of fitness apps to help you navigate the crowded landscape of health and wellness technology.

The Good

Fitness apps offer a plethora of benefits that can enhance your fitness journey. One of the most significant advantages of these apps is the convenience they provide. With just a few taps on your smartphone, you can access personalized workout plans, track your calorie intake, and even connect with a community of like-minded individuals for support and motivation.

Moreover, many fitness apps come equipped with features that can help you stay on track and achieve your fitness goals. From reminders to drink water, to notifications for upcoming workouts, these apps can serve as a virtual personal trainer in your pocket, guiding you every step of the way towards a healthier lifestyle.

Additionally, fitness apps often offer a variety of workouts to choose from, catering to different fitness levels and preferences. Whether you prefer high-intensity interval training, yoga, or dance workouts, there is a fitness app out there that can provide you with the exercises you enjoy.

The Bad

While fitness apps can be incredibly beneficial, there are also some drawbacks to be aware of. One of the main concerns with fitness apps is the potential for inaccuracies in tracking. Whether it’s miscounting your steps or overestimating the number of calories burned during a workout, relying solely on a fitness app for accurate data can sometimes lead to skewed results.

Another issue to consider is the impact that constant connectivity to a fitness app can have on your mental health. While these apps can be great motivators, they can also create a sense of pressure and obsession with tracking every aspect of your fitness journey. This can lead to feelings of guilt or inadequacy if you fall short of your goals, ultimately taking away from the enjoyment of exercise.

The Ugly

Perhaps the most concerning aspect of fitness apps is the potential for them to promote unhealthy behaviors and unrealistic body standards. With the rise of social media influencers and fitness gurus promoting extreme workout routines and restrictive diets, some fitness apps may inadvertently perpetuate harmful messages about body image and self-worth.

Moreover, the gamification aspect of many fitness apps, such as rewarding users with points or badges for completing workouts, can create a dangerous cycle of exercise addiction. This can lead to overtraining, burnout, and even serious injuries if not approached with caution and moderation.

In conclusion,

Fitness apps have undoubtedly transformed the way we approach health and wellness, offering a wealth of resources and support at our fingertips. However, it’s essential to approach these apps with a critical eye and a mindful attitude towards balance and moderation. By leveraging the benefits of fitness apps while being aware of their limitations and potential pitfalls, you can harness the power of technology to enhance your fitness journey in a safe and sustainable way.
